In This Role You Will:
  • Perform routine and corrective maintenance to keep community buildings, grounds, and equipment in safe, working condition.
  • Complete assigned work orders, documenting repairs accurately and closing them promptly upon completion.
  • Troubleshoot and assist with repairs related to plumbing, electrical, HVAC, carpentry, and other building systems within your scope of training.
  • Perform apartment turnovers and renovations, including patching, painting, cleaning, and preparing units for resident move‑ins.
  • Replace HVAC filters, light bulbs, and perform general upkeep on building systems and furnishings.
  • Install appliances and equipment, hang pictures, and assemble or disassemble furniture as needed.
  • Assist contractors with on‑site work at the direction of leadership.
  • Maintain clean, safe, and organized work spaces, tools, and storage areas.
  • Perform all duties in accordance with safety procedures, securing work areas and using protective equipment as required.
  • Monday – Fridays (9am-5pm), with rotating weekends.
Who You Are:
  • You have a high school diploma or GED equivalent.
  • You have experience using basic hand and electrical tools.
  • You are willing to participate in on‑call, weekend, or irregular‑hour rotations as needed.
  • You are able to learn new skills and acquire technical knowledge through on‑the‑job training.
  • You can read technical manuals, follow instructions, and perform basic math and measurements.
  • Preferred: plumbing, electrical, and HVAC experience and certifications.
